Altima SE L4-2.4L (KA24DE) (1997)
Parking Brake Lever: Adjustments
1. Adjust clearance between shoe and drum/pad and rotor as follows:
a. Release parking brake lever and loosen adjusting nut.
b. Depress brake pedal fully at least 10 times with engine "running."
2. Pull control lever 4 - 5 notches. Then adjust control lever by turning adjusting nut.
3. Pull control lever with 196 N (44 lbs.) of force. Check lever stroke and ensure smooth operation. Number of notches is 7 - 8
4. Bend warning lamp switch plate to ensure that:
a. Warning lamp comes on when lever is lifted 1 or less notches.
b. Warning lamp goes out when lever is fully released.
Toggle Lever And Stopper Relationship
5. Before or after adjustment, pay attention to the following points:

For rear disc brake, ensure toggle lever returns to stopper when parking brake lever is released.

Be sure there is no drag when parking brake lever is released.
